January 1, Trump’s Friday Plans: Private Strategy Moves

Wyatt’s Take
- President Trump starts with a breakfast alongside governors.
- He follows up with a private meeting in the Oval Office.
- No press briefings are scheduled for the day.
Friday’s White House schedule is all business for President Trump. He’ll begin with a 9:30 AM working breakfast joined by a group of governors in the State Dining Room.
At 10:30 AM, he shifts to the Oval Office for a private, closed-door meeting. The press is left out for the morning, as no public briefings have been set.
